What Sets Exceptional Bookkeeping Apart

Not all bookkeeping services are created equal. The difference between basic data entry and professional bookkeeping services lies in several key factors:

Accuracy and Attention to Detail 📝
Professional bookkeepers catch discrepancies that automated systems miss. They reconcile accounts meticulously, ensuring every transaction is categorized correctly and every penny is accounted for.

Strategic Financial Insights 💡
Beyond recording transactions, exceptional bookkeeping services provide actionable insights. They identify spending patterns, flag unusual expenses, and help businesses understand their financial health at a glance.

Proactive Problem-Solving 🔍
The best bookkeeping companies don’t just report problems—they anticipate them. They spot cash flow issues before they become critical and identify opportunities for cost savings.

Regulatory Compliance ⚖️
Staying compliant with ever-changing tax laws and financial regulations requires constant vigilance. Professional services ensure businesses meet all requirements without the stress of tracking regulatory changes.

Hidden Costs of DIY Bookkeeping

Many business owners underestimate the true cost of handling bookkeeping internally:

Opportunity Cost ⏰
Every hour spent on bookkeeping is an hour not spent on revenue-generating activities. For a business owner whose time is worth $100/hour, spending 10 hours monthly on bookkeeping represents $12,000 in lost opportunity annually.

Error Correction 🔧
Mistakes in bookkeeping compound over time. Fixing errors discovered months later can cost 5-10 times more than preventing them initially.

Software and Training 💵
Accounting software subscriptions, updates, and ongoing training represent significant hidden expenses that professional services bundle into their pricing.

Stress and Burnout 😰
The mental load of managing finances while running a business contributes to decision fatigue and burnout, affecting overall business performance.

Integration Ecosystems 🌐

The power of modern bookkeeping multiplies through integrations:

Banking Integrations provide automatic transaction feeds, eliminating manual data entry and reducing errors.

Payment Processor Connections ensure sales data flows seamlessly into accounting records with proper categorization.

Inventory Management Links keep COGS calculations accurate and inventory valuations current.

Time Tracking Integrations connect billable hours directly to invoicing and revenue recognition.

The Human Element: Why Technology Alone Isn’t Enough

Despite remarkable advances in accounting automation, the human element remains irreplaceable in quality bookkeeping services. Here’s why:

Professional Judgment 🧠

Algorithms categorize transactions based on patterns, but humans understand context. When an expense could reasonably fall into multiple categories, experienced bookkeepers make nuanced decisions based on tax implications, reporting needs, and business strategy.

Relationship Building 🤝

Effective bookkeeping requires understanding the business beyond numbers. BooksOnTime’s professionals develop relationships with clients, learning their industries, recognizing their challenges, and anticipating their needs—something no software can replicate.

Strategic Advisory 📊

While software generates reports, humans interpret them. Professional bookkeepers identify concerning trends, spot opportunities, and translate financial data into actionable business intelligence.

Adaptability and Problem-Solving 🔧

Unique situations arise regularly in business. Human bookkeepers adapt procedures, find creative solutions, and handle exceptions that fall outside programmed parameters.

Quality Assurance 🎯

Automated systems make mistakes—incorrect categorizations, failed integrations, or data corruption. Human oversight catches these errors before they compound into serious problems.
